Corus to buy Shaw Media

First Published:

 

A shake-up in the broadcast industry Wednesday morning.

Corus Entertainment says it’s entered into an agreement to buy all of Shaw Media from Shaw Communications for $2.65 billion.

Shaw Media includes the Global Television Network and 19 specialty channels including HGTV Canada, Food Network Canada and Showcase.

Corus already owns a number of other specialty TV channels as well as a network of radio stations and Nelvana Animation Studio.

Combined Shaw Media and Corus employ more than 4,000 people and there could be possible job reductions as a result of this deal.

Both companies are already controlled by the Shaw family through its multiple-voting shares.
